    摘要:

    在Pro/E中建立自行火炮协调器的三维模型,将模型简化后导入RecurDyn软件中建立虚拟样机模型并结合实验数据进行校核,验证样机的正确性。通过设置液压系统和驱动电机故障参数,对模型进行动力学仿真分析,通过故障仿真结果与正常仿真值的对比得出液压-控制系统在不同故障参数下对仿真结果的影响,为协调器液压-控制系统故障检测和维修提供一定的参考。

    Abstract:

    The software Pro/E was used to build the three dimensional (3D) model of the coordinator of selfpropelled gun. The software Recurdyn was used to build the virtual prototype model of the coordinator after the model was simplified, then verification was carried out by integrating with experimental data for the correctness of sample. By setting the failure parameters of driving motor and hydraulic system, the model was dynamically analyzed with simulation. By comparing normal simulation values with results from failure simulation, the impacts of simulation results by different failure parameters of the hydrauliccontrol system were obtained. It is valuable reference for failure detecton and troubleshooting of the coordinator of hydrauliccontrol system.
